Protection of the superior laryngeal nerve in the process of thyroid surgery

Abstract
Objective To investigate the effect of strengthening the protection of superior laryngeal nerve from injury in the thyroid surgery on the reduction of injury rate of the superior laryngeal nerve.Methods From August 2011 to July 2013,108 patients were operated with thyroid surgery through improving the traditional operation method,and protecting the superior laryngeal nerve from injury.Results There was no superior laryngeal nerve injury among the 108 patients through postoperative clinical observation.Conclusions The injury rate of the superior laryngeal nerve is significantly reduced by improving the traditional operation method,and protecting the superior laryngeal nerve during operation.
